Apps Script-無料のApps Scriptコード生成

AIでGoogle ワークスペースを自動化および拡張する

Home > GPTs > Apps Script
このツールを評価する

20.0 / 5 (200 votes)

Google Apps Script の紹介

Google Apps Scriptは、Googleワークスペースプラットフォームでの軽量なアプリケーション開発のためのクラウドベースのスクリプト言語です。 Sheets、Docs、Drive、Calendar、GmailなどのGoogle製品全体でのタスクの自動化を可能にします。多くの場合、シンプルなJavaScriptコードを使用しています。非プロの開発者とエキスパートの両方にアクセスしやすいように設計されています。 たとえば、シンプルなスクリプトはGoogleスプレッドシートで反復的なタスクを自動化できます。または、複雑なスクリプトは、Googleサービスと統合されたウェブアプリを作成できます。 Powered by ChatGPT-4o

Google Apps Script の主な機能

  • スプレッドシートタスクの自動化

    Example Example

    Googleスプレッドシートでのデータの自動フォーマット

    Example Scenario

    スプレッドシート内のデータエントリを自動的にフォーマットおよび並べ替えするスクリプトは、データ分析の時間を節約します。

  • Googleシートでのカスタム関数

    Example Example

    複雑な式を計算するためのカスタム関数の作成

    Example Scenario

    ネイティブでは利用できない複雑な計算を実行するユーザ定義関数を開発し、スプレッドシートの機能を拡張します。

  • カスタムメニューとUIの作成

    Example Example

    Googleドキュメントにカスタムメニューを追加

    Example Scenario

    Google Docsに特定のタスク(書式設定や定型文の挿入など)を実行するカスタムメニューを追加するスクリプトは、ユーザーの生産性を向上させます。

  • Googleカレンダーの管理

    Example Example

    Googleカレンダーでのイベント作成の自動化

    Example Scenario

    特定のトリガーや入力に基づいてカレンダーイベントを自動的に作成・更新するスクリプトは、スケジューリングプロセスを合理化します。

  • Gmailとの対話

    Example Example

    Gmailを介した自動メールの送信

    Example Scenario

    特定のトリガー(フォーム送信や特定の日付など)に応じて自動的にメールを送信するスクリプトは、コミュニケーション効率を向上させます。

Google Apps Script の理想的なユーザー

  • 非プロの開発者

    基本的なコーディングスキルを持つ個人は、Apps Scriptを使用してルーチンタスクを自動化し、Googleワークスペースアプリケーションでの生産性を向上させることができます。

  • 教育者と学生

    教育者は管理タスクを自動化したり、インタラクティブな教育コンテンツを作成したりできます。また、学生はプロジェクトやコーディングの基礎を学習するのに役立ちます。

  • ビジネスプロフェッショナル

    様々な分野の専門家は、データ管理やレポート作成など、Googleワークスペース環境内のビジネスプロセスを自動化および合理化できます。

Apps Scriptを使用するためのガイドライン

  • はじめに

    サインインやChatGPT Plusへのサブスクライブなしで、yeschat.aiを訪問して無料トライアルを開始してください。Apps Scriptの機能を理解するための最初の重要なステップです。

  • 基本を理解する

    Apps ScriptはJavaScriptベースなので、JavaScriptについて理解してください。基本的な概念と機能を理解するために、GoogleのApps Scriptドキュメントを確認してください。

  • Google Apps Scriptにアクセス

    Googleスプレッドシート、ドキュメント、またはフォームファイルを開きます。[拡張機能]に移動し、[Apps Script]を選択して、スクリプトエディタにアクセスします。

  • スクリプトを書き始める

    Googleワークスペース内のタスクを自動化するためのシンプルなスクリプトから始めましょう。組み込みのサービスとAPIを利用して、Googleスプレッドシート、ドキュメントなどの機能を拡張します。

  • 実験し学ぶ

    カスタム関数の作成、ワークフローの自動化、外部APIとの統合など、一般的なユースケースを探索してください。 定期的な練習と実験は、あなたのスキルを向上させるでしょう。

Apps Scriptに関する詳細なQ&A

  • Google Apps Scriptは主に何のために使用されていますか?

    Google Apps Scriptは、主にSheets、Docs、FormsなどのGoogleワークスペースアプリケーションを自動化、拡張、統合するために使用され、カスタム機能、アドオン、ワークフローの作成を可能にします。

  • Apps Scriptは外部APIと対話できますか?

    はい、Apps ScriptはUrlFetchサービスを使用して外部APIにリクエストを送信できるため、サードパーティのサービスとの統合が可能で、Googleワークスペースアプリケーションの機能を拡張できます。

  • Apps Scriptを使ってウェブアプリケーションを作成できますか?

    はい、できます。Apps Scriptを使用してウェブアプリケーションを構築できます。これらはスタンドアロンのウェブアプリとして、またはGoogleシート、ドキュメントなどのGoogleサービスと対話する形でデプロイできます。

  • Apps Script はデータセキュリティとプライバシーをどのように扱っていますか?

    Apps Scriptは、Googleの厳格なデータセキュリティとプライバシープロトコルに準拠しています。スクリプトはGoogleのサーバーで実行され、セキュアなデータ処理のためにさまざまな認証とアクセス許可レベルを設定できます。

  • Google Apps Scriptの使用に制限はありますか?

    強力ではあるものの、Apps Scriptには実行時間の制限とクォータの制限があります。 主にGoogle ワークスペース内のタスクの自動化に適していて、重い計算タスクには適していません。